Area Code 620

Kansas

Area code 620 serves Kansas, primarily Hutchinson, in the Central Time (CT) time zone. It was created from a split of area code 316.

Split Area Code

This area code was created by splitting an existing area code into separate geographic regions. When a split occurs, some customers in the original area code region are assigned the new area code.

This area code was split from area code 316 (Wichita).

In service since: 03-Feb-2001

History

Area code 620 was created from a split of area code 316. It was introduced in 2001 as part of a geographic division to provide additional numbering resources.

Demographics

The estimated population served by area code 620 is approximately 1,133,802. The population density is 8 people per square mile, which is lower than the national average of 93. The median household income is $60,498, which is lower than the national median of $75,144. Approximately 23.7%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, compared to the national rate of 33.7%. This rate is lower than the national average. The poverty rate stands at 12.2%, which is near the national rate of 11.5%.
